.toolkit-section{background:var(--second_alt_color);padding-top:var(--padding-top-desktop);padding-bottom:var(--padding-bottom-desktop)}.toolkit-section .sub-heading{color:var(--primary_light_color);text-transform:uppercase;letter-spacing:.14em;margin:0;font-family:DM Sans Medium;font-weight:500}.toolkit-section .heading{color:var(--text-primary);margin-top:10px}.toolkit-section .description{color:var(--text-secondary);margin:12px 0 0;line-height:1.6}.toolkit-section .bottom-content-wrapper{gap:32px;margin-top:14px;padding:32px 40px;background:var(--dark-section);border-radius:20px}.toolkit-section .bottom_subheading{font-size:10px;font-weight:600;letter-spacing:.1em;color:#ffffff59;margin-bottom:10px}.toolkit-section .bottom_heading{font-size:24px;color:var(--text-white);max-width:400px;line-height:1.3;margin-bottom:8px}.toolkit-section .bottom_desc{color:#ffffff80}.toolkit-section .bottom_price{font-size:44px;font-family:var(--font-heading-family);color:var(--text-white);line-height:1}.toolkit-section .bottom-content-right{gap:20px}.toolkit-section .guarantee-text{font-size:11px;color:#ffffff59;margin-top:4px}.toolkit-section .bottom_btn{background:var(--white-color);color:var(--primary_light_color);border:none;border-radius:10px;font-weight:700;cursor:pointer;margin-top:5px;display:block;white-space:nowrap;height:48px;padding:12px 28px}.toolkit-section .related-products{display:grid;grid-template-columns:repeat(3,1fr);gap:20px;margin-top:40px}.toolkit-section .related-product-box{background:var(--white-color);border:1px solid #E6E2DA;border-radius:20px;padding:20px;gap:16px;transition:all .2s;position:relative}.toolkit-section .related-product-box:hover{transform:translateY(-3px);box-shadow:0 6px 24px #14120e17,0 2px 6px #14120e0d;border-color:#cec9c0}.toolkit-section .related-product-inner{gap:16px}.toolkit-section .product-subheading{font-size:10px;font-weight:500;color:var(--text-muted)}.toolkit-section .product_icon{width:52px;height:52px;border-radius:12px;display:flex;align-items:center;justify-content:center;font-size:24px;flex-shrink:0;background:#e5f2ec}.toolkit-section .product-title{font-size:15px;font-weight:500;color:var(--text-primary);font-family:var(--font-body-family);margin-bottom:4px;line-height:1.3}.toolkit-section .product-price{font-family:var(--font-heading-family);color:var(--text-primary)}.toolkit-section .product-short-desc{font-style:italic;line-height:1.5;margin-bottom:14px;color:var(--text-muted)}.toolkit-section .related-prod-btn{height:34px;padding:0 14px;font-size:12px;font-weight:500;border-radius:8px;background:#f0ede6;border:1.5px solid #e6e2da;color:var(--text-secondary);transition:all .18s;flex-shrink:0;cursor:pointer;position:relative;font-family:var(--font-body-family)}.toolkit-section .related-prod-btn:hover{border-color:var(--primary_light_color);color:var(--primary_light_color);background:#e5f2ec}.toolkit-section .related-prod-btn .btn-spinner{position:absolute;top:55%;left:50%;transform:translate(-50%,-50%)}.toolkit-section .related-prod-btn svg{height:16px;width:16px}cart-drawer:not(.is-empty) .drawer__inner-empty{display:none!important}.toolkit-section.template-color .related-prod-btn:hover,.toolkit-section.template-color .bottom_btn,.toolkit-section.template-color .sub-heading{color:var(--dark-primary-color)}.toolkit-section.template-color .related-prod-btn:hover{background:var(--light-color);border-color:var(--dark-primary-color)}.toolkit-section .toolkit-top-wrapper{gap:10px}.toolkit-section .top-btn{background:transparent;color:#383631;border:1.5px solid #cec9c0;padding:10px 16px}.toolkit-section.collection-color .related-prod-btn:hover,.toolkit-section.collection-color .bottom_btn,.toolkit-section.collection-color .sub-heading{color:var(--dark-color)}.toolkit-section.collection-color .related-prod-btn:hover{background:var(--light-color);border-color:var(--dark-color)}.toolkit-section.collection-color .bottom-content-right{gap:5px;flex-direction:column}.toolkit-section.collection-color .heading{max-width:450px}@media screen and (max-width:1024px){.toolkit-section .bottom-content-wrapper{gap:15px;padding:24px}.toolkit-section .related-products{gap:15px}.toolkit-section .related-product-inner{gap:10px}.toolkit-section .product_icon{width:42px;height:42px;font-size:18px}}@media screen and (max-width:767px){.toolkit-section{padding-top:var(--padding-top-mobile);padding-bottom:var(--padding-bottom-mobile)}.toolkit-section .bottom-content-left,.toolkit-section .bottom-content-right{width:100%}.toolkit-section .bottom-content-right{justify-content:center;gap:10px}.toolkit-section .bottom_price{font-size:36px}.toolkit-section .related-products{grid-template-columns:1fr}.toolkit-section.collection-color .bottom-content-right{gap:10px;flex-direction:row}}
/*# sourceMappingURL=/cdn/shop/t/2/assets/toolkit-section.css.map */
